Birthday: 1944-12-23
Place of Birth: Chicago, Illinois, USA
Biography: Wesley Kanne Clark, Sr. is a retired general of the United States Army. He graduated as valedictorian of the class of 1966 at West Point and was awarded a Rhodes Scholarship to the University of Oxford, where he obtained a degree in Philosophy, Politics and Economics.
